Hello bobegilbert,

To start off we suggest you begin reading the whitepaper of Satoshi Nakamoto which can be found here.

After reading this you should move on to the book The Internet of Money by Andreas Antonopoulos a leading blockchain expert. This book covers the importance of bitcoin and why it is necessary that such a development found place. Through a collection of lectures Antonopoulos describes the historical, social and economical problems that can be solved with the help of this technology.

If you want to know more about the technical aspects of bitcoin, we suggest reading the book written by Andreas Antonopoulos: Mastering Bitcoin. Even though the title suggests it is about bitcoin, it also covers the blockchain technology extensively.

To fully understand the implications of the blockchain as seperate development we would recommend the Blockchain Revolution written by Dan and Alex Tapscott. This book focusses more on the actual use cases of the blockchain technology and its potential. It also sketches a possible future across a number industries and the outcomes the blockchain technology could offer.

Another suggestion for getting a better understanding of the blockchain is the book written by Melanie Swan: Blockchain: Blueprint for a new economy. This book focusses more on the underlying technology of bitcoin, the blockchain. The book covers the application of blockchain in the industries where it could have the most positive impact namely: the government, software, healthcare and research sector.
